Output 3c56b59b55bd0af198173aa419ad380aee00dc9b3dae3c9477540848c2a1ec86:0

value
289646
script pubkey
OP_0 OP_PUSHBYTES_20 837439bc88236e6ef7d5ead8f70af9384598e67e
address
bc1qsd6rn0ygydhxaa74atv0wzhe8pze3en7532m2u
transaction
3c56b59b55bd0af198173aa419ad380aee00dc9b3dae3c9477540848c2a1ec86
confirmations
314567
spent
true